Key Responsibilities at Northwell Health

In this pivotal role, you'll assess management development needs and coach leaders on critical healthcare attributes. Key duties include:

  • Evaluate organizational structures during annual processes to address performance gaps and develop top talent.
  • Partner with leaders on performance management, compensation, and succession planning.
  • Implement HR strategies supporting business goals in Danbury, Connecticut jobs.
  • Develop people plans aligned with employer-of-choice initiatives.
  • Participate in sourcing exceptional management talent.
  • Oversee employee relations, ensuring timely investigations and positive environments.
  • Manage union relationships and labor negotiations.
  • Analyze data on engagement, retention, and diversity to propose solutions.
  • Foster transparent communication organization-wide.
  • Lead cross-system HR projects for exceptional service delivery.
  • Mentor HR team members on processes and tools.

Qualifications & Requirements

To excel in Sr. Human Resources Business Partner Careers at Northwell Health, candidates need:

  • A Bachelor's Degree (Master's preferred) in HR, Business, or related field.
  • 10-12+ years progressive HR Generalist/HRBP experience, ideally in healthcare.
  • Deep knowledge of HR disciplines: talent acquisition, employee relations, compensation, benefits.
  • Proven labor relations and union negotiation expertise.
  • Strong business acumen and data analytics skills.
  • Experience coaching leaders on change management and performance.
  • SPHR/SHRM-SCP certification preferred.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ills for stakeholder management.
